Hi Jason,

> +
> +     if (init_done == 0) {
> +             i2c_init(CONFIG_SYS_I2C_SPEED, CONFIG_SYS_I2C_SLAVE);
> +             init_done = 1;
> +     }

As I can see, i2c_init is called during initialization in
arch/arm/lib/board.c. Why do we need to call it again ?

> +     if (write) {
> +             buf[0] = (val >> 16) & 0xff;
> +             buf[1] = (val >> 8) & 0xff;
> +             buf[2] = (val) & 0xff;
> +             if (i2c_write(CONFIG_SYS_FSL_PMIC_I2C_ADDR, reg, 1, buf, 3))
> +                     return -1;
> +     } else {
> +             if (i2c_read(CONFIG_SYS_FSL_PMIC_I2C_ADDR, reg, 1, buf, 3)) {
> +                     return -1;
> +             ret_val = buf[0] << 16 | buf[1] << 8 | buf[2];
> +             }

I am wondering if it works. The line with ret_val is never reached. Do
you tested it ?
